When working with survivors of sexual abuse and/or trauma, solution-based therapists honor the agency of the survivors. What does this mean?
 
  A) Solution-based therapists insist the survivor share the details of their abuse
  B) Solution-based therapists take a more directive role in working with the survivor
  C) Solution-based therapists allow the client to decide whether or when to tell their abuse story
  D) Solution-based therapists determine the pacing of the therapy

For about 100 years, scientists thought that peptic ulcers were caused by stress, spicy food, and alcohol. Later, researchers added stomach acid to the list of causes and began treating ulcers with antacids. Now it is known that peptic ulcers are predominantly caused by Helicobacter pylori, a spiral-shaped bacterium that normally exist in the stomach.
